Table of Contents:
  • Lake histories. Pluvial lake sizes in the Northwestern Great Basin throughout the Quaternary Period / by Robert M. Negrini
  • Pliocene to Middle Pleistocene lakes in the Western Great Basin : ages and connections / by Marith C. Reheis ... [et al.]
  • Pleistocene lakes and paleoclimates (0 to 200 Ka) in Death Valley, California / by Tim K. Lowenstein
  • Bonneville Basin Lacustrine history : the contributions of G.K. Gilbert and Ernst Antevs / by Charles G. Oviatt
  • Fluvial linkages in Lake Bonneville subbasin integration / by Dorothy Sack
  • Aquatic biotic perspectives. Environment and paleolimnology of Owens Lake, California : a record of climate and hydrology for the last 50,000 years / by J. Platt Bradbury and R.M. Forester
  • Biogeography and timing of evolutionary events among the Great Basin fishes / by G.R. Smith ... [et al.]
  • Basins and ranges : the biogeography of aquatic true bugs (Insecta: Heterptera) in the Great Basin / by Dan A. Polhemus and John T. Polhemus
  • Biogeography of Great Basin aquatic snails of the genus Pyrgulopsis / by Robert Hershler and Donald W. Sada
  • Anthropogenic changes in biogeography of Great Basin aquatic biota / by Donald W. Sada and Gary L. Vinyard
  • Non-aquatic biotic and hydroclimatic perspectives. Late Neogene environmental history of the Northern Bonneville Basin : a review of palynological studies / by Owen K. Davis
  • Great Basin vegetation history and aquatic systems : the last 150,000 years / by Peter E. Wigand and David Rhode
  • Great Basin mammals and Late Quaternary climate history / by Donald K. Grayson
  • Great Basin peoples and Late Quaternary aquatic history / by David B. Madsen.
